I got one today. He looks amazing in person! The most cartoon-accurate looking Starscream toy I've seen so far.
And if his horizontal stabilisers folded like the Henkei version (which I also want) and the nosecone folded all the way to his back the toy would have been even better.
His nosecone in the cartoon was almost always grey, which I prefer, but it is blue in the three AKOM episodes so I'm okay with it. The jet looks great.
